Question:
Im very interested in the CTEK MULTI US 7002 12-Volt Universal Battery Charger for my 2005 e46 M3 which is currently using an optima red top. My question is, what is the best method of attachment for my particular set up? I see there are multiple options available. I was thinking the eyelets for a semi-permanent method of attachment, or maybe the cigarette lighter? Id appreciate any advice you can provide. Thank you,
asked by: Gregory F
Expert Reply:
The CTEK MULTI US 7002 12-Volt Universal Battery Charger w/ Pulse Maintenance and Backup Power, # CTEK56353, is an excellent charger and maintainer. It is maintencence free and utilizes an 8-step system to constantly monitor and maintain 12V battery charge. For connection, I recommend using the quick-disconnect system with the eyelet-terminal cable to permanantly attach to your battery terminals. This will give you the quick plug function and will prevent you from needing to double check connections each time and has a cap to keep moisture and debris out. This will make for the best connection between the charger and your battery.
If you want to go with the cigarette lighter adapter and use your vehicle's wiring to the battery, the CTEK Comfort Connect Cigarette Plug Charger Cable, # CTEK56263 will work well inside your vehicle. The charger is rated for indoor or outdoor use, and this is the easiest connection option for most people.
